Associate Project Manager – Bioanalytical
Work Schedule – Monday – Friday (Day Shift) / Madison, Wisconsin
Labcorp is seeking a Associate Project Manager to join our team at our Madison location in Madison, WI !
Job Responsibilities
Act as the primary client advocate within the Bioanalytical organization
Act as a central point of contact for both internal and external clients
Capture, clarify and provide visibility to client expectations
Deliver clear, timely, and concise updates to clients
Provide accurate data and insights to support capacity planning and resource forecasting
Identify, escalate, and support the resolution of project-related issues
Support contract review, project budgeting, and financial reconciliation
Minimum Qualifications:
Bachelor's Degree in Life Sciences (e.g. Biology, Chemistry, etc.) with 3 or more years experience in a CRO, Pharmaceutical or Biotech environment
1 year or more working with internal or external clients
Preferred Qualifications:
1 year or more Client-facing experience
1 year or more experience within a laboratory environment
Project Management Certification

We are seeking a Bioanalytical Project Manager to join our team in Madison. In this role, you will act as the central point of contact for both internal and external clients, ensuring seamless delivery of bioanalytical projects from initiation through completion. You will manage communication, timelines, milestones, and financial components while coordinating cross-functional teams to deliver on client commitments.
